Features

  • Quick-drying polyester/spandex fabric offers soft, comfortable stretch
  • bluesign®-approved odor-resistant treatment regenerates between launderings for freshness that lasts
  • UPF 50+ fabric provides excellent protection against harmful ultraviolet rays
  • Underarm panels reduce bulk and effectively wick sweat
  • Seam-free shoulder design provides comfort under pack straps

Sizing Notes

Measurements are stated in inches unless otherwise indicated. Size chart values represent body measurements, not garment measurements.

SHORT: Some pants are available in short sizes, which generally means an inseam that is 2.5 inches shorter than regular sizes.

TALL: Some pants, shirts, jackets and parkas are available in tall sizes, which generally means an inseam that is 3 inches longer and a rise that is 1 inch longer, a shirt or jacket body that is 2 inches longer, a parka body that is 2.5 inches longer and sleeves that are 2.5 inches longer than regular sizes.

Capri or cropped pants have an intentionally shorter inseam—reference the technical specs instead of this chart.

Inseam is measured to the floor.

Good shirt for warm weather

Overall, this shirt is a solid choice if you are looking for a UPF 50 rated long sleeve to block the sun. It is lightweight and comfortable, and does a good job wicking away sweat to help keep you dry. However, the sleeves are a very athletic cut, which doesn't give much airflow to your arms. In hot weather, a looser fit in the sleeves would be preferable to give better ventilation. Thus, I would recommend this shirt for warm, but not extremely hot, environments. Summer hiking at high elevations (where the temps might not be extreme, but the UV exposure most certainly *is*) would be an excellent place for this shirt.
